Abstract

The invention discloses a kind of screen luminance adjustment methods, this method comprises: output screen brightness regulation interface, item is dragged comprising brightness regulation in the screen intensity adjustment interface, when detect user the brightness regulation dragging item endpoint default gesture when, obtain the object brightness that the default gesture is directed toward, the brightness adjustment of screen is not the object brightness within the scope of the threshold brightness of brightness regulation dragging item instruction by the object brightness.The invention also discloses a kind of screen brightness regulating device, a kind of terminal and computer readable storage medium, the brightness regulation range to current screen can be expanded, the terseness of operation is improved, and improved and meet a possibility that with the needs of eye health.

Background technique
Intelligent terminal is more more and more universal in life, greatly facilitates people's lives, but also people are to mobile whole End produces very strong dependence, can all spend in using mobile terminal for a long time in one day, before sleeping at night under dark surrounds Be likely under outdoor strong light using, and eyes screen is shown be it is very sensitive, the brightness of screen directly affects user With eye health, often appear under dark surrounds and to adjust screen intensity to minimum but feel screen very It is bright, or brightness has adjusted highest but has still less seen clearly the content in screen outdoors.
In the prior art, by identifying the environmental light brightness of surrounding using external light sensor, in ambient light Dynamic regulation screen intensity when variation, but such regulative mode adjusting brightness range is smaller, is still unable to satisfy maintenance and uses The demand of family eye health.Alternatively, by the method for setting contextual model, different scene modes correspond to the bright of different screen Degree, but such mode adjust it is inflexible, adjust brightness range it is limited.

Referring to Figure 1, Fig. 1 is the flow diagram for the screen luminance adjustment method that first embodiment of the invention provides, should Screen luminance adjustment method can be applicable in the terminal with touch screen, which may include that mobile phone, tablet computer etc. are mobile eventually In end, in the terminal device that may also comprise other adjustable screen intensitys with touch screen, this method comprises:
S101, output screen brightness regulation interface drag item comprising brightness regulation in the screen intensity adjustment interface;
Referring to fig. 2, Fig. 2 is to contain the screen intensity adjustment interface of brightness regulation dragging item 11.
In response to the instruction of user, alternatively, preset event is detected, for example, detecting a triggering output screen Time conditions, output screen brightness regulation interface drags item comprising a brightness regulation in the screen intensity adjustment interface, should Brightness regulation dragging item on is provided with dragging label 12, when user drag on the dragging item drag label 12 when, terminal according to The corresponding relationship of position and screen intensity of the dragging label 12 of systemic presupposition on the dragging item adjusts screen intensity.
S102, when detecting that user in the default gesture of the endpoint of brightness regulation dragging item, obtains the default gesture The object brightness of direction, the object brightness is not within the scope of the threshold brightness of brightness regulation dragging item instruction;
The brightness regulation drags the threshold brightness range of item instruction, refers to and drags dragging label from one end of the dragging item To the dragging item the be adjustable screen of the other end brightness minimum value to the range between maximum value.
When detecting user in the default gesture of the endpoint of brightness regulation dragging item, obtain what the default gesture was directed toward Object brightness, the object brightness is not within the scope of the threshold brightness of brightness regulation dragging item instruction, i.e., the object brightness is greater than Maximum value in the threshold brightness range, alternatively, the object brightness is less than the minimum value in the threshold brightness range, that is, should Threshold brightness range of the object brightness beyond brightness regulation dragging item instruction.The adjustable extent of the object brightness is the screen The extreme value range that can reach when design.
Specifically, when detecting user when the brightness regulation drags the default gesture of the endpoint of item, the default hand is obtained The object brightness that gesture is directed toward is divided into following two mode:
First way: being provided with brightness icon at the endpoint of brightness regulation dragging item, in brightness regulation dragging item The default gesture of endpoint includes: to be designated as starting point upward sliding or slide downward with the luminance graph of brightness regulation dragging endpoint Gesture.The brightness icon can be 1, at wherein 1 endpoint of brightness regulation dragging item, be also possible to 2, respectively At 2 endpoints of brightness regulation dragging item.
Referring to Fig. 3,2 are designated as with the luminance graph, for being located at 2 endpoints of brightness regulation dragging item, In, brightness icon 21 is located at the endpoint of brightness regulation dragging instruction brightness maximum, and brightness icon 22 is located at the brightness At the endpoint for adjusting dragging instruction brightness minimum.It take bright spot icon 21 as the gesture of starting point upward sliding, expression will increase Screen intensity, take bright spot icon 22 as the gesture of starting point slide downward, and expression will reduce screen intensity.
It should be noted that when the luminance graph is designated as 1, when referring to Fig. 3, only brightness icon 22, with bright spot icon 22 be the gesture of starting point upward sliding, and expression will increase screen intensity, take bright spot icon 22 as the gesture of starting point slide downward, table Show screen intensity to be reduced.
When detecting user in the default gesture of the endpoint of brightness regulation dragging item, obtain what the default gesture was directed toward Object brightness is specifically as follows: when detecting that user is designated as starting point and slid up with the luminance graph of brightness regulation dragging endpoint When dynamic gesture, the corresponding first object brightness of gesture that starting point upward sliding is designated as with the luminance graph, the first object are obtained Brightness is higher than the brightness of current screen, detects that user has been designated as with the luminance graph of brightness regulation dragging endpoint alternatively, working as When the gesture of point slide downward, corresponding second object brightness of gesture that starting point slide downward is designated as with the luminance graph is obtained, it should Second object brightness is lower than the brightness of current screen.

The second way: referring to fig. 4, the first brightness icon 21 and the are respectively arranged at the both ends of brightness regulation dragging article Two brightness icons 22, the default gesture of the endpoint of brightness regulation dragging article include: the first brightness icon 21 or this The gesture or long-pressing gesture of predetermined times are clicked on two brightness icons 22, which can be 2 times, 3 times or other numbers. The long-pressing gesture refers to that Continued depression reaches preset time period to user's finger on the screen, for example, reaching 2 seconds.
When detecting user in the default gesture of the endpoint of brightness regulation dragging item, obtain what the default gesture was directed toward Object brightness is specifically as follows: when detect first luminance graph put on click predetermined times gesture or long-pressing gesture when, The gesture for clicking predetermined times or the corresponding first object brightness of long-pressing gesture for obtaining and putting in first luminance graph, this One object brightness is higher than the brightness of current screen;
Alternatively, when detect second luminance graph put on click predetermined times gesture or long-pressing gesture when, obtain with In the gesture or corresponding second object brightness of long-pressing gesture of the click predetermined times that second luminance graph is put on, second target Brightness is lower than the brightness of current screen.
S103, by the brightness adjustment of screen be the object brightness.
After obtaining the object brightness that the default gesture is directed toward, the present intensity of screen is adjusted to the object brightness.
